Checking Out the Various Kinds of Roofing Services Available for Your Home When thinking about roofing services for a residential or commercial property, numerous choices accommodate details needs and challenges. From routine assessments that identify prospective concerns to emergency situation repairs that address unforeseen damages, each solution plays an important https://martinpwafk.educationalimpactblog.com/57087483/metal-roofing-vs-asphalt-shingles-pros-and-cons-explained-by-experts